I have to agree with the above poster, if you want the utility to annoy people, I would suggest you run full AP with the Ion Cylinder. That way, you have an on demand slow with retractable blade with the proper talents, an AoE slow with the 3 stacks of the prototype flamethrower, an interrupt on a 6 second cooldown, guard, taunt, and Hydraulic Overrides.
